Explore the fascinating world of plant life with M. C. Stopes's "The Study of Plant Life," a classic introduction to botany ideal for young readers and anyone curious about the natural world. This meticulously prepared edition offers a timeless exploration of plants, designed to spark an early interest in science education. Delve into the fundamental principles of plant biology, from the structure of flowers to the vital processes that sustain plant life.
Perfect for elementary-level learning, this book provides a clear and engaging overview of the botanical world. Discover the wonders of the natural world in a simple and accessible way. This edition preserves the original text while ensuring clarity for a contemporary audience interested in juvenile nonfiction and the foundations of scientific study.
